This is according to "American Lager" water profile with Brun Water.

To achieve a relatively close water profile, will need 80:20 Distilled to Regina water.

Finished water profile will be approximately:
Calcium: 11.6
Magnesium: 7.2
Sodium: 25.6
Chloride: 11.8
Sulfate: 56.2
Bicarbonate: 47.9

Notes

Multistep mash: 132F for 15 minutes; 142F for 30 minutes; 152F for 30 minutes; 160F for 20 minutes; and 168F for 10 min. Boil for at least 90 minutes, following the hop schedule. Aerate wort well and knock out the wort at 48-50F. Pitch yeast. Ferment at 52F until you have about 2-3P from terminal and raise the temperature to 60F for a diacetyl rest.

Once terminal gravity is reached, crash 1-2F per day until you reach lagering temperatures of 31-32F. Lager for at least 4 weeks, but preferably 6-8.

PH should be 5.3-5.4.
